02.ナレッジ

「試験当日にサーバーダウン…」の悲劇を防ぐ。大規模テストを支えるシステム安定性とリスク回避の仕組み

最終更新:

「さあ、いよいよ本番だ」。数ヶ月間この日のために勉強してきた数千人の受験生が、午前10時ちょうどに一斉にオンライン試験の開始ボタンをクリックする。 その瞬間、画面が真っ白になり「503 Service Unavailable(サーバーに接続できません)」という無機質なエラーメッセージが表示される——。

これは決してフィクションではありません。オンライン教育や検定試験が普及した現在、このような「アクセス集中によるサーバーダウン」は、主催者にとって最も恐れるべき経営リスクの一つです。

本日は、システム障害がもたらすビジネスへの致命的なダメージと、大規模なアクセスを安全にさばくための現実的なシステムの仕組みについて解説します。

「可用性(Availability)」の欠如がもたらすブランド崩壊

情報セキュリティの三大要素(CIA)の一つに「可用性(Availability)」という概念があります。これは「システムが止まることなく、ユーザーが使いたい時にいつでも使える状態を維持すること」を指します。

オンラインスクールや検定試験において、この「可用性」が損なわれることは、単なるITの不具合では済みません。 過去に実際に起きたある大規模なオンライン資格試験の事例では、開始時刻にアクセスが殺到してサーバーがダウン。復旧までに数時間を要しました。結果として、受験のために仕事を休んで待機していた受講生たちの怒りがSNSで爆発し、大炎上。主催団体は、受験料の全額返金だけでなく、再試験の実施費用という甚大な経済的損失を被り、何より「この団体の試験は信用できない」というブランドイメージの失墜という取り返しのつかないダメージを受けました。

日常的な学習動画の視聴であれば「少し時間をおいてから見よう」で済むかもしれませんが、日時が指定された試験やライブ配信においては、1分のサーバーダウンが命取りになるのです。

💡 【ポイント】 日時指定の試験やイベントにおけるサーバーダウンは、単なるシステムエラーではなく、全額返金や炎上に直結する重大な経営リスク(可用性の喪失)である。

なぜサーバーは落ちるのか?「サウンダリング・ハード問題」の恐怖

では、なぜ企業が用意したサーバーは落ちてしまうのでしょうか。「サーバーの性能が低いから」と片付けられがちですが、根本的な原因は「トラフィック(通信量)の偏り」にあります。

コンピューターサイエンスの世界では、多数のユーザーが全く同時に1つのシステムにリクエストを送り、システムがパンクしてしまう現象を「サウンダリング・ハード問題(Thundering Herd problem:群れがドッと押し寄せる現象)」などと呼びます。

例えば、1日かけてパラパラと1万人が訪れるウェブサイトは、一般的なサーバーでも余裕で処理できます。しかし、「午前10時00分00秒」のたった1秒間に、1万人が一斉に「ログイン」や「テスト開始」のボタンを押した場合、サーバーには瞬時に通常の何万倍もの負荷がかかり、処理能力の限界を超えてフリーズしてしまうのです。 これは、普段はスムーズに流れている高速道路の料金所に、お盆休みの初日に車が殺到して大渋滞を引き起こすのと同じ原理です。

💡 【ポイント】 サーバーダウンの最大の原因は、全体のアクセス数ではなく「特定の瞬間にアクセスが一点集中すること」。試験などの「一斉スタート」はシステムにとって最も過酷な状況である。

クラウド技術を用いた「現実的な負荷対策(スケーリングと冗長化)」

「絶対にダウンしない魔法のサーバー」というものは、この世に存在しません。GoogleやAmazonのような世界的IT企業でさえ、障害を起こすことはあります。 しかし、現代の適切なLMS(学習管理システム)であれば、クラウド技術を活用して「ダウンする確率を極限まで下げ、万が一の際も瞬時に持ちこたえる仕組み」を構築しています。

大規模アクセスに耐えるためには、主に以下の2つのアプローチが用いられます。

  • オートスケーリング(負荷に応じた自動拡張): アクセスが急増したことをシステムが検知すると、自動的に仮想サーバーの数を「2台→10台→50台」と瞬時に増やして負荷を分散させる技術です。スーパーのレジに行列ができたら、自動的に他のレジを次々と開けてお客さんをさばくようなイメージです。
  • 冗長化(バックアップ体制の確保): システムを単一障害点(そこが壊れたら全てが止まる箇所)にしないための設計です。「サーバーA」と「サーバーB」を常に並行稼働させておき、万が一「サーバーA」に障害が発生しても、ユーザーに気づかれることなく瞬時に「サーバーB」が処理を引き継ぐ仕組み(フェイルオーバー)などを指します。
  • edulioをはじめとするエンタープライズ(法人・大規模)向けのLMSでは、こうしたクラウドネイティブな負荷対策や冗長化設計が標準で組み込まれています。

    💡 【結論】 絶対に落ちないサーバーは存在しないが、クラウドの「オートスケーリング(自動拡張)」や「冗長化(予備システム)」を備えたLMSを選ぶことで、アクセス集中によるダウンの危険性を現実的かつ大幅に回避できる。

    システム安定性は「見えない顧客サービス」

    普段、システムが正常に動いている間は、誰もインフラのありがたみを感じません。しかし、「当たり前に動くこと」を担保するための裏側のインフラ設計こそが、いざという時に受講生の努力とあなたのビジネスを守る最後の砦となります。

    特に、一斉試験や大規模な研修をオンラインで実施する企業・協会にとって、システムの安定性は「見えない顧客サービス」そのものです。単なる機能の多さや表面的なコストだけでなく、「万が一の負荷にどう備えているか」という視点でプラットフォームを選ぶことが、長期的な信頼獲得に繋がります。

    ▼ 具体的な費用感が知りたい方へ edulioを導入した場合の具体的な費用がWeb上で即時わかる、スピード見積もり機能もご利用いただけます。 [最短30秒!スピード見積もり発行はこちら]